Output 62d6fa58554e04ace83dd1a262dc0d676a325a000ee198d514264ca5e8c07940:9

value
54299462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b4f8f7f5363c8ebf8071c8b2dda9dd98b2ffbc OP_EQUAL
address
MRZPSePpDNyUxfeFWGKDV4VUHduDw38MX9
transaction
62d6fa58554e04ace83dd1a262dc0d676a325a000ee198d514264ca5e8c07940
spent
true